Transaction 1354fb734ec2ac20fb300640acf427c3b2efffe35596b51af37bf37d33d5104a
1 Input
1 Output
-
1354fb734ec2ac20fb300640acf427c3b2efffe35596b51af37bf37d33d5104a:0
- value
- 2424893
- script pubkey
- OP_0 OP_PUSHBYTES_20 eceb46a03c10b098140e4f44cf5140029bf504a6
- address
- bc1qan45dgpuzzcfs9qwfazv752qq2dl2p9x5um8k3